IV. How to Care for Garden Furnishings
Once you’ve chosen the perfect garden furnishings, it’s important to know how to care for them so that they will last for years to come. Here are a few tips:
-
Store your garden furnishings in a dry place when not in use. This will help to prevent them from rusting, rotting, or otherwise deteriorating.
-
Clean your garden furnishings regularly to remove dirt, dust, and debris. This will help to keep them looking their best and extend their lifespan.
-
Protect your garden furnishings from the elements. If you live in an area with harsh weather conditions, you may need to cover your furniture or bring it indoors during storms or extreme temperatures.
-
Repair any damage to your garden furnishings as soon as possible. This will help to prevent the problem from getting worse and will extend the life of your furniture.
By following these tips, you can help to keep your garden furnishings looking their best for years to come.

VI. Garden Furnishings for Small Spaces
If you have a small yard or patio, don’t despair! There are still plenty of stylish garden furnishings that will fit in your space. Here are a few tips for choosing the right furnishings for a small garden:
- Choose lightweight and portable furnishings that can be easily moved around.
- Look for furnishings that have multiple functions, such as a bench that can also be used as a planter.
- Choose furnishings in neutral colors that won’t overwhelm the space.
- Add pops of color with flowers, plants, and other decorations.
Here are a few specific examples of stylish garden furnishings that would work well in a small space:
- A bistro set with a small table and two chairs
- A hanging chair or swing
- A small table and chairs made from reclaimed wood
- A planter box with a built-in bench
With a little creativity, you can create a stylish and inviting garden oasis in even the smallest of spaces.

VII. Budget-Friendly Garden Furnishings
When it comes to furnishing your garden, you don’t have to spend a fortune. There are plenty of affordable options available that will still give your outdoor space a stylish and inviting feel. Here are a few tips for finding budget-friendly garden furnishings:
-
Shop around. Compare prices from different retailers before you make a purchase. You may be able to find the same item for a lower price at another store.
-
Look for sales and discounts. Many retailers offer sales on garden furnishings throughout the year, so be sure to keep an eye out for these opportunities.
-
Consider buying used or refurbished furniture. You can often find great deals on gently used or refurbished garden furniture.
-
DIY your own garden furniture. If you’re handy, you can save money by building your own garden furniture. There are plenty of tutorials available online and in books.
With a little bit of planning and effort, you can easily find budget-friendly garden furnishings that will add style and function to your outdoor space.
